What is the opportunity?

​This is an exciting opportunity to lead the design of end-to-end technical solutions spanning Enterprise systems and core infrastructure. The Solution Architect is a passionate technologist and influencer; bringing valuable hands-on experience to drive us toward our adoption of cloud technology and modern system integration for emerging Enterprise information systems, and resilient architectures for crucial business applications.


What will you do?

  • Efficiently manage the solution design process, including: liaising with key stakeholders, engaging additional subject matter experts; creating, documenting and presenting solutions which best meet business and technical strategy and requirements; navigating current state environment constraints and alignment with future target architecture.
  • ​Ensure that solutions are well balanced delivering needed functionality to business units without compromising security or privacy.
  • ​Define repeatable architecture patterns and blueprints for design and implementation solutions using Archimate and other techniques.
  • ​Define data architecture around how data is captured, stored, processed, distributed and consumed by applications in alignment to the overall data strategy and design artifacts in UML Class Diagrams.
  • ​Support the development of comprehensive data mapping and integration strategy roadmaps, providing input to ensure project investments are moving towards the target state architecture.
  • ​Liaise with development/engineering teams to ensure that all solution architecture views are defined and elaborated contributing to an Architectural Continuum that is continuously growing.
  • ​Deliver architectures and designs in both agile and iterative waterfall project delivery models, and propose and implement improvements to improve the viability of the solutions to meet program timelines, budget and quality measurements.
  • ​Facilitate small to large group meetings for reviewing technical architecture, decision making and problem solving.
  • ​Understand technology trends and the practical application of existing, new, and emerging technologies to enable new and evolving business and operating models. Understand, advocate and augment the principles of information technology strategies.
  • ​Analyze the business-IT environment to detect critical deficiencies, and recommend solutions for improvement.
